The Mayor of Charlottetown, His Worship George MacDonald, has announced that a Municipal By-Election will be held in Charlottetown - Ward No. 2 Belvedere - on Monday 16 February 1998 to elect a councillor to serve on the municipal council. The Belvedere councillor position became vacant with the resignation of Councillor Richard Brown on 4 December 1997.
The City of Charlottetown has appointed Mr. Merrill Wigginton (Elections P.E.I.) as Chief Electoral Officer for the 16 February 1998 municipal by-election. Elections P.E.I. will exercise general direction and supervision over the administration and conduct of the election. Elections P.E.I. is a nonpartisan independent office of the Legislative Assembly of Prince Edward Island.
The City of Charlottetown has opted to use the list of electors compiled for the 3 November 1997 Charlottetown Municipal Election. The city will conduct a revision to this municipal List of Electors for Ward No. 2 Belvedere.
Elections P.E.I. will be mailing each qualified elector a Confirmation of Registration card to officially notify each elector that his or her name appears on the List of Electors for Ward No. 2 Belvedere. If the name or address shown is incorrect or if any elector in your household does not receive a Confirmation of Registration card please phone Elections P.E.I. at (902) 368-5895 or (902) 368-5898. Twelve days have been set aside for the registration of eligible voters. Registration will begin on 14 January 1998 and will end on 27 January 1998. Enumerated electors who receive a copy of the Confirmation of Registration card are asked to please keep his or her card and to take the card with them to the polling station when they vote. This card contains the dates, times and locations of the advance polls and as well the ordinary poll on election day. Should it happen that an eligible elector is missed during this update period the elector may still be able to vote on Election Day 16 February 1998 by going to his or her polling station and swearing the Oath of Elector prior to voting.
Chief Electoral Officer Merrill Wigginton said, "the update to the list of electors is very important in compiling the List of Electors for the 16 February municipal by-election. All eligible electors should make every effort to have his or her name on the List of Electors by registering with Elections P.E.I."
To be eligible to vote in the 16 February municipal by-election a person must be; 1) at least 18 years of age on Election Day, 16 February 1998; 2) a Canadian citizen; 3) and ordinarily resident in the city for a period of six months preceding the date of the election.
